Tech Support and RMA: Epox 9NDA3+

Our support evaluation procedure tries to determine the responsiveness of manufacturers to Technical Support problems. Our procedure:

The way our Tech Support evaluation works is first, we anonymously email the manufacturer's tech support address(es), obviously not using our AnandTech mail server to avoid any sort of preferential treatment. Our emails (we can and will send more than one just to make sure we're not getting the staff on an "off" day) all contain fixable problems that we've had with our motherboard. We allow the manufacturer up to 72 hours to respond, and then we will report whether or not they responded within the time allotted, and if they were successful in fixing our problems. In case we don't receive a response before the review is published, any future responses will be added to the review, including the total time it took for the manufacturer to respond to our requests.

The idea here is to encourage manufacturers to improve their technical support as well as provide new criteria upon which to base your motherboard purchasing decisions. As motherboards become more similar everyday, we have to help separate the boys from the men in as many ways as possible. Epox Support can be found by visiting their U.S. website at http://www.epox.com/USA/support.asp. Users need to register to access some sections of the Support options, but the registration process is very simple and straightforward. In addition to the options for contacting support and creating trouble tickets, the user can access a knowledge base by model and download the latest BIOS and drivers.

The RMA process is also described at the US website and the RMA application can be filed on-line. Unlike some other manufacturers, Epox has a very flexible RMA process that will handle RMAs directly from the US office if the customer prefers, without a lot of front-end hassle to return a product for repair or replacement. The procedure is very straightforward.

There are also dedicated Epox websites for Europe, Germany, China, and a global site in both English and Mandarin. In addition, partner sites are available in the UK, Russia and Turkey.

For US customers, Technical Support can be obtained in the Support submenu. As far as email tech support response time was concerned, Epox did fine in our first attempt to measure Tech Support turnaround time. We received a reply to our question in 15 hours. While the time was fast and the answer was friendly, we did not find the answer particularly helpful in resolving our theoretical problem. The answer was one potential answer to the issue, but it appeared more a canned database response than a careful look at what we had asked. Perhaps we were looking for too much in this first test, but overall, the reply time was quite good.

We will be more confident in Epox support when we have had more opportunities to test the quality of Epox support. In fairness, we were also asking questions about a motherboard that has just reached the US market. In fact, the board is not even listed as a product on the US website, though it does appear on the Global Epox site.

  • Wesley Fink - Thursday, October 28, 2004 - link

    I have tested with the new 10/26 and 10/28 BIOS and the issues still are not fixed. Results remain the same as reported in this review.

    Below is the email I sent to Epox:

    "I have retested the Epox 9NDA3+ with the new BIOS and the 4 dimm issue is NOT fixed. No matter what I set in BIOS with 4 dimms the system boots at DDR320 at 2T (The BIOS states on boot DDR400@166, but CPU-Z reports actual CPU speed as 160x2). I have tested with:

    4x512MB Corsair 3200XL v1.1
    4X512MB OCZ PC3200 Platinum Rev.2
    4X512MB G. Skill TCCD
    4X512MB Corsair CMX512-4400C25PT (DDR550)

    I also tested each of the 4 memories at SPD timings at DDR400 and at a forced 3-3-3-10 at DDR400, even though all 4 are rated at DDR400 2-2-2-5. Same results in both sets of tests. In addition the Epox still hangs on reboot more than 50% of the time. The PS is a OCZ PowerStream 520W. Memory Timings were checked with CPU-Z version 1.24 which is a free download at www.cpuid.com. Memory Speed was confirmed in SiSoft Sandra 2004.

    Do you have any further suggestions?"
